    About this album

    Band Of Gypsys is a crucial live statement from Jimi Hendrix, marking a bold shift from psychedelic guitar heroics towards tighter, funkier, blues-driven improvisation. Recorded at New York’s Fillmore East and released in 1970, it features Hendrix with Billy Cox and Buddy Miles in a trio whose chemistry brought a harder groove to his sound. The set includes the monumental “Machine Gun”, often hailed as one of his greatest performances, alongside “Who Knows” and “Changes”. Released after The Jimi Hendrix Experience dissolved, the album helped redefine Hendrix’s legacy as an artist who could turn live performance into political, musical and emotional force.
